EF Series, EFF Type Flex Suppressor Sheet
EF Series flexible sheet is a polymer base blended with micron sized magnetic powders dispersed into the material
The EF Series are effective for resonance and wave suppression generated in electronic devices, and can be cut into virtualy any shape

Product Application Information
EF Series applications include radiation noise suppression for electronic equipment, Quasi-microwave range interference prevention inside and in between electronics, Mobile communications equipment, wireless equipment (Wi-Fi, Bluetooth), office automation equipment (personal computers,TFT LCDs etc.), communication terminals in audio/video equipment, digital exchanges, etc
